Upcycling vs Recycling: What’s the difference?
Recycling breaks down materials. Destruction -> Remanufacturing. Materials are broken down for example plastic melted, fabric pulped. The quality decreases and this process usually requires large amounts of energy and water.

Upcycling upgrades them. Preservation -> Transformation. Materials stays intact and the design in YNG elevates their value. It uses much lesser energy and each item is absolutely unique. Is upcycling clean and safe?
100%. All YNG materials go through full cleaning and sanitisation processes before they are turned into products or used in workshops. And at YNG, every material goes through a strict sanitisation process.

  1. Coffee grounds are dried, sterilised, heat treated to ensure complete drying. Mould free

  2. Upholstery fabrics are washed, steam sanitized, and inspected

  3. Old clothes are also washed and pre treated before being turned into every product you see

We only use materials that meet our internal quality standards: Clean, Strong, Durable and Safe.

Are upcycled products durable?
Yes. Durability depends on the original material and how one uses it. Upholstery material is strong, T-shirt cotton is soft but sturdy, banner canvas material is extremely strong, coffee soap is long lasting and exfoliating. Upcycled doesn’t mean fragile - it means smart. Because these materials mostly have already ‘lived’, we know how they perform.
